This Day In History: September 7, 1885 - Hill Valley, California. Eastwood defeats Tannen and The Wreck of the 131

Thumbnail
gallery
124 Upvotes

On the morning of Monday September 7, 1885 Clint Eastwood, a stranger who first appeared in Hill Valley days earlier, defeated notorious outlaw Buford "Mad Dog" Tannen in a duel in front of the Palace Saloon. Eastwood was then seen leaving town with local blacksmith Emmett Brown. Schoolteacher Clara Clayton, who had just moved to the town, was also spotted leaving Hill Valley soon after.

Eastwood and Brown were next seen robbing the Central Pacific Railroad westbound train, which was led by locomotive 131. Unlike typical train robberies of the time, where passengers were stripped of valuables or the baggage/cargo cars were raided, Eastwood and Brown stole the locomotive itself for unknown reasons.

Locomotive 131 was switched onto a track leading to Shonash Ravine, where a bridge was being constructed. Eastwood and Brown proceeded in the locomotive and Clayton was witnessed chasing them on horseback. Because the next events occurred in an isolated area away from Hill Valley, the exact actions of Eastwood, Brown, and Clayton were unknown. The burnt remnants of locomotive 131 were later discovered in Shonash Ravine, having gone over the unfinished bridge.

Eastwood is assumed to have plummeted into the ravine with locomotive 131, perishing in its fiery crash. As a memorial to his death and heroic defeat over Tannen, the ravine was renamed Eastwood Ravine.

Why is November 5 1955 a red letter date in the history of science?

0 Upvotes

So Doc is showing Marty how to use the DeLorean. He says you can see the signing of the Declaration of Independence, and puts in July 4 1776. Or witness the birth of Christ on December 25 0000. Or the red letter date in the history of science, November 5 1955.

But then he gets lost in thought for a second and says ā€œyes…of course…November 5 1955! That was the day in invented time travel!ā€ It’s clearly played as though he wasn’t thinking about that when he first put in the date, and only remembered it after he said it out loud. So why was he calling it a red letter date before he remembered that?

I guess since Doc is meant to be a little scatterbrained, you could say he remembered that this date was important without actually remembering WHY it was important until he said it out loud. I don’t know - it always struck me as a little strange the way Lloyd played those lines.

Mary Steenburgen is sharing her appreciation for a costar who became a dear friend.

The actress shared a recent photo of herself and Christopher Lloyd on Instagram. Along with the recent photo, she also shared photos of her and her Back to the Future III costar in different instances over the years. The two first worked together on 1978’s Goin’ South.
